During your pre-clinical studies (Years 1-3), you are taught through lectures and practical classes (including 120 hours of dissection across the three years) in the central science departments, and College supervisions you can typically expect 20-25 timetabled teaching hours each week. Applicants who have lived outside of the UK for 6 months or more in the last 5 years will still need to complete a satisfactory enhanced DBS check but will also have to provide relevant overseas checks to cover these periods of time and complete a self-declaration form. Within the clinical phase, two mornings each week are given over to practical clinical work including basic clinical examination of the main domestic species, radiography, post-mortem investigation and visits to external establishments such as the University-affiliated RSPCA clinic where you actively participate in delivering morning clinic consultations.
